Nevada Office of the Attorney General
The Nevada Attorney General's Office issued a solicitation waiver to award a noncompetitive (sole‑source) contract to Sophus Consulting, Inc. to upgrade the ProLaw legal case management system. Work includes upgrading to a current ProLaw version, migrating existing systems and databases to new virtual servers hosted by GTO, and providing consulting services for testing, issue resolution, and implementation of features such as the ProLaw Web Suite, Groupware Email agent, SSRS, and a test environment. The anticipated contract period begins after approval (anticipated start 2026-07-15) and ends 2027-06-30; responses are due 2026-07-06.

Board meetings and strategic plans from Nevada Office of the Attorney General
The task force discussed proposed statutory language changes for the Open Meeting Law, specifically focusing on the definitions of meetings, public officers, and exceptions for ceremonial, social, and training functions. The group considered whether to remove or refine specific subsections of the statute to reduce confusion and unnecessary complaint filings. The consensus focused on simplifying the language while ensuring clarity regarding the scope of what constitutes a meeting, with discussions on whether to keep, edit, or remove provisions regarding social, ceremonial, and training events.

The committee discussed current project status, SAVIN grant expenditures, and matching requirements. The members deliberated on potential participation in Justice Exchange, reviewed future project funding strategies involving various grant sources, and considered legislative options. Additionally, the committee addressed questions regarding VINEWATCH access for participating agencies, the potential inclusion of bail amounts and charge details on VINELink, and received updates on public service announcements and marketing subcommittee activities.

The committee reviewed and approved requests for domestic violence continuing education credits and formal training. Several agencies, including Great Basin Counseling Services and Safe Nest, were granted certification renewal. The committee approved new programs, specifically the Smart Choices Certified Domestic Violence Treatment Program and the New Frontier Treatment Center. Additionally, the committee addressed the approval of new providers and supervisors, granting approval for Michelli Kaltsas, while continuing the application for Dwayne Brown to a future meeting.
